15-hour National USPAP Course - McKissock 2023 Questions and Answers Passed 
 
USPAP contains what 4 sections? 
1) The Preamble 
2) Definitions 
3) Rules 
4) Standards 
USPAP Provides... 
1. A common basis for comparison 
2. A reference source for all users of the document 
3. A basis for uniform enforcement for state regulatory agencies 
4. A reason for clients, other intended users, and the public to place their trust in the services performed by professional appraisers

Basic Appraisal Procedures - McKissock Study guide with complete solution 
 
Valuation Process 
Systematic set of procedures an appraiser follows to provide answers to a clients questions about real property value 
Appraisal Process 
1. Define Problem 
2. Determine scope of work 
3. Gather Record & verify dat 
4. determine highest and best use 
5. estimate land value 
6. est. value by all three approaches 
7. Reconcile est. value into final opinion value 
8. report the final opinion
